What if your brain isn’t just reacting to the world, but actually helping to create it?

In this episode, Paul Ashcroft and Garrick Jones are joined by world-renowned cognitive philosopher Andy Clark to explore the fascinating ideas behind his latest book, The Experience Machine.

Together, they dive into how the brain acts less like a camera and more like a prediction engine, constantly guessing what’s coming next and shaping the way we experience reality. From the link between curiosity and mistakes to the surprising ways our expectations influence pain and mental health, this is a rich conversation about perception, learning, and the stories we tell ourselves.

They also look at how embracing uncertainty drives growth and innovation, and how AI, algorithms, and education are shaping the way we think.

About The Curious Advantage Book
The Curious Advantage is an exploration of the idea of Curiosity and its increasing importance for thriving in the digital age. Taking the widest possible exploration of things Curious – historical, contemporary, neuro-scientific, anthropological, behavioural, semantic and business-focused. At the heart of the book is our model of Curiosity, called ’Sailing the 7C’s of Curiosity’. This model provides individuals with a practical framework for how to be successfully Curious and use Curiosity as a power skill to unlock their own potential.
